Understanding Your Warranty and What It Covers

Before touching a single screw, it’s essential to understand what your robot vacuum’s warranty actually protects. Most manufacturers offer a standard 1- to 2-year limited warranty that covers defects in materials and workmanship under normal use. However, warranties typically exclude damage caused by improper handling, unauthorized repairs, or liquid exposure beyond recommended cleaning procedures.

The key misconception is that “opening” the device automatically voids the warranty. In reality, U.S. law (under the Magnuson-Moss Warranty Act) prevents companies from voiding a warranty solely because a consumer performed maintenance—unless the manufacturer provided specific instructions stating that certain actions would invalidate coverage.

That said, if internal damage occurs during cleaning—such as breaking a sensor wire or spilling water into the motor compartment—the manufacturer may deny a claim, arguing negligence rather than honoring the defect clause.

“Consumers have the right to maintain their devices, but that right comes with responsibility. Cleaning is encouraged, disassembly beyond user-accessible parts is where risks begin.” — David Lin, Consumer Electronics Repair Advocate
Tip: Always consult your user manual before cleaning. If it shows how to remove a side cover or dustbin assembly, that part is considered user-serviceable and safe to handle.

Step-by-Step Guide to Safely Clean the Interior

Cleaning the inside of your robot vacuum doesn’t mean dismantling the entire unit. Focus on accessible areas where dust, hair, and debris accumulate—especially around brushes, sensors, and airflow channels. Follow this timeline-based process every 4–6 weeks for optimal performance.

  1. Power Down and Remove Battery (if applicable): Turn off the robot and unplug it from charging. Some models have removable batteries; if yours does, take it out to eliminate electrical risk.
  2. Detach the Dustbin and Main Brush: These are almost always designed for easy removal. Empty the bin completely and rinse it with water only if the manual allows. Let it air dry for at least 2 hours before reinserting.
  3. Clear the Brush Roll Chamber: After removing the main brush, inspect the chamber where it sits. Use a small handheld vacuum or soft brush to remove trapped lint and hair. Avoid metal tools that could scratch plastic housings.
  4. Wipe Internal Sensors and Charging Contacts: Locate the cliff sensors (usually near the bottom rim) and charging contacts. Gently wipe them with a dry microfiber cloth. For stubborn grime, slightly dampen the cloth—but never spray liquid directly onto components.
  5. Check Airflow Pathways: Look along the suction channel from the brush area to the filter housing. Use compressed air in short bursts to dislodge fine dust buildup. Do not blow air into motors or electronic boards.
  6. Reassemble and Test: Once everything is dry and debris-free, reattach all parts securely. Run a short cleaning cycle to ensure proper operation.

This method keeps your robot running efficiently without crossing into restricted zones. No screws need to be removed, no circuitry exposed—just smart, targeted cleaning.

Do’s and Don’ts: Internal Cleaning Best Practices

To help you stay within warranty-friendly boundaries, here’s a clear breakdown of recommended and prohibited actions when cleaning inside your robot vacuum.

Do’s Don’ts
Use a soft brush or compressed air on visible dust traps Submerge the robot body in water
Remove and wash the filter (if washable) Use solvents like alcohol or acetone on plastic surfaces
Inspect and clear side brush mounts Force open sealed compartments or pry off covers
Wipe sensors with a dry or slightly damp cloth Disassemble the main housing or battery compartment
Refer to official support videos or manuals Modify internal components or install third-party parts

Sticking to the “Do’s” ensures you’re performing preventive maintenance—not repair or modification—which manufacturers generally encourage.

Real Example: How Sarah Avoided a Costly Mistake

Sarah, a homeowner in Portland, noticed her Roborock Q5 was losing suction after three months of daily use. She found online tutorials showing full teardowns to clean the fan unit. Tempted to follow, she nearly unscrewed the baseplate when she remembered her warranty was still active.

Instead, she checked Roborock’s official support site and discovered a video demonstrating how to remove the roller, filter, and bin for deep cleaning—all without opening the chassis. She used a narrow paintbrush to reach behind the brush housing and cleared a thick tangle of pet hair blocking airflow.

After reassembling, suction returned to full strength. More importantly, when she later had an issue with navigation, customer support honored her warranty because there was no sign of unauthorized tampering.

Sarah’s experience highlights a crucial point: official resources often provide safe, effective solutions that match or exceed DIY hacks—without the risk.

Essential Tools and Supplies Checklist

You don’t need specialized equipment to clean your robot vacuum properly. Here’s a simple checklist of items that will make the job easier and safer:

  • Microfiber cloths (lint-free)
  • Small, soft-bristle brush (like a clean toothbrush)
  • Compressed air can (optional but helpful)
  • Tweezers or needle-nose pliers (for pulling out hair)
  • Cotton swabs (for tight spaces)
  • Mild dish soap (only for washable filters or bins, if permitted)
  • Digital copy of your user manual (keep it handy on your phone)

Frequently Asked Questions

Can I wash the dustbin with soap and water?

Yes, but only if your user manual explicitly states it’s safe. Most plastic bins can be rinsed under lukewarm water and cleaned with mild soap. Never use hot water or abrasive scrubbers. Always let the bin dry completely—preferably overnight—before reinstalling.

What happens if I accidentally get moisture on the motherboard?

If liquid reaches internal electronics, immediately power down the device, remove the battery (if possible), and let it air dry in a warm, ventilated area for at least 48 hours. Do not plug it in or attempt to charge it. Even small amounts of moisture can cause corrosion over time. While this won’t automatically void your warranty, claims related to liquid damage are often denied unless proven otherwise.

Is it okay to use third-party replacement parts?

Using non-OEM filters or brushes usually won’t void your warranty outright, thanks to the FTC’s recent rulings on repair rights. However, if a third-party part causes damage—such as a poorly fitting filter letting dust into the motor—the manufacturer may refuse to cover resulting failures. Stick to reputable brands or original components when possible.

Expert Tips for Long-Term Maintenance

Regular cleaning isn’t just about performance—it extends the life of your investment. Consider these advanced strategies to keep your robot vacuum healthy between deep cleans:

  • Schedule monthly maintenance alerts: Set a recurring calendar reminder to check brushes, filters, and sensors.
  • Monitor filter condition: Foam or HEPA filters should be replaced every 6–12 months, depending on usage. Washable ones should be cleaned every 1–2 months.
  • Keep firmware updated: New software updates often include improved cleaning patterns and error detection that reduce strain on mechanical parts.
  • Store in a climate-controlled area: Extreme heat or humidity can degrade internal plastics and adhesives over time.

Manufacturers design these devices with maintenance in mind. The more you treat your robot vacuum like a precision tool rather than a disposable gadget, the longer it will serve you—warranty or not.
